  • You could slap his wrist for saying it, but then he said it with his face, and you could spank him for making faces, but then he said it with his eyes, and there were limits to correction-no way, in the end, to penetrate behind the blue irises and eradicate a boy's disgust.

    Jonathan Franzen (2001). “The Corrections: A Novel”, p.263, Macmillan
